Human activity consists of two areas |
Human presence and human patterns |
|
Human presence consists of |
Visual indicators that suggest humans have been in the immediate vicinity’s |

Human patterns are |
Associated with identifiable factors of human movement and IED emplacement |
|
Human patterns consist of |
Well worn trails Well traveled routes Choke pints Known enemy ttps |
|
Things of Visual Processing (what you see) |
Outlines Shapes Value (contrast) Texture Shine Rhythm |
|
What’s identifiable characteristics (what you perceive) |
Disturbance Color change (hme can leak and stain) Regularly (straight lines) Flattening Transferring (movement from 1thing to another) |
|
Visual inductors ground spoor |
Regularly Flatting Transference Color change Disturbance |
|
What’s aerial spoor |
Damage or disturbance to vegetation created by the passage of the enemy from foot to head |

Aerial spoor consist of |
Crushed broken or bent vegetation Leaf creases Crushed or bruised leaves plants or twigs Broke or stripped branches twigs or leaves Skinned bark or knocks Vegetation out of place |
|
Sign/Ground sign |
Any indicator other then ground or aerial spoor |
|
Sign can be defined as |
Any change from the natural/normal state |
|
Sign consist of |
Broken cobwebs Displaced vegetation or stones Disturbed insect nests Animal or bird alarms Water splashes and deposits |

What lighting is optimal |
Daylight is normally optimal However moonlight artificial light ambien light can be just as good |
|
Most tracking will be conducted during |
The day |
|
When exploiting ground sign |
Use all available light to the max |
|
The golden rule of tracking ground sign |
Place tracks between the tracker and the sun |
|
S.T.Y means |
Sun,tracks, you |
|
Proper viewing angle concept is most noticeable during? |
Early morning and late afternoon |
|
What happens when the sun reaches it zenith |
Light shines right into the print washing out the shadows |
|
Most effective times for viewing angles |
First light till 1030 1530 until sunset |
|
Least effective times for viewing angles |
1100-1300 |
|
How far should you look ahead |
As far as you can see ground sign approx-15-20M |
|
Scanning too close to your feet can cause |
Slowing you down Lose track of terrain Losing your SA Exposing to ambush Headache and eye strain |
